Advantages of Charitable Contributions
Charitable contributions are not only a wonderful way to support those in need but can also offer significant tax benefits. When you donate to a qualified charity, you may be able to reduce your taxable income, resulting in a refund. The amount of your tax deduction depends on the type of contribution and if it is a cash donation or an itemized deduction.
It's essential to keep accurate records of your donations, including proof, as you will need them to claim your tax filing. Consulting with a qualified tax expert can guide you in understanding the full range of tax benefits available to you through charitable giving.

Unlocking Tax Savings: A Guide to Charitable Giving
Charitable giving is a wonderful opportunity to contribute to causes you are passionate about, while also potentially reducing your tax burden. With making strategic donations, you can deduct a portion of your contributions on your tax return. In order to attain your tax savings through charitable giving, research the following tips:
- Talk to a qualified tax professional. They can guide you on the best strategies for your situation.
- Research different charitable organizations and their mission. Choose causes that are meaningful to you.
- Don't waiting until the last minute to make your donations. Plan ahead and contribute throughout the year.
- Keep accurate records of all contributions. This will guarantee you have the necessary documentation for tax purposes.
